We have several kind of download links for different reasons:

1) ugene.net - it is part of the web site. We can store any kind of data here (images/small read-only docs).

2) github.com: we host our release packages on GitHub starting from v 34.

3) B2 links: we store big old releases/youtube videos today (pre-github) for free (today). Later we can start paying for this hosting and add more data there..

4) archive.ugene.net - here we host 100Gb+ data for NGS tools for free. This is old and outdated data. I see no future for these data sets unless someone will volunteer to support that tools/datasets.

5) drive.google.com/drive/folders/ - here we store small individual downloadable documents. We use it by historical reasons.

6) ugeneunipro.github.io - there should be no such links anymore.

Finally IMO we should have only github & b2 links, but this task is out of scope (has too low priority) today. The main goal today is to have all links working for users.
